  2. Deep wounds work on strange mechanic (similar to mages ignite). If you would apply dw before previous dw expired on target - you are refreshing the dot and adding new damage to it -> ticks do more damage - it can stack to very high numbers.


    Example:
    Warrior just applied DW that should apply 15k dmg in 3 ticks - each tick is supposed to do 5k damage. -> after first tick he applies new DW that is supposed to do 15k damage again. What happens is that first 5k from first DW were applied, but next 10K were not -> it adds up -> so there is fresh DW on target now that should deal 25k damage -> each tick for 8.33K

    ^outdated info, sry... (this is how it used to work before MoP)

  5. As of 5.0.1 the old deep wounds is removed which used to proc on crit and stack with itself, MOP deep wounds is a renamed Rend and buffed slightly, this new version does not stack with itself, this mechanic is long gone from deepwounds.
